    Why 5 stars? Because the vodka sauce could end wars. --- --- --- I have had this place bookmarked from previous visits to Grapevine and we finally made it a priority to stop in this time. The amazing reviews do not lie - this place rocks. We were considering ordering the bruschetta and then we found out it was complementary. That was a great start, and an even better start is that it was top notch. I don't think I'd be bored of this even if I ate it every day for the next 5 years. I ordered the lobster ravioli and while it was quite tasty, my wife made the point that you wouldn't even know that it was lobster if you tried it blindly. But it was still great, so I wasn't too mad about it. Where the vodka sauce really shined was through the Rigatoni a la Vodka. My wife and I both agreed that this was our favorite of the meal. The house dressing for the salad was kind of weird: definitely a tomato based dressing, which we weren't expecting, but I didn't hate it. The two red sauce entrees: lasagna and chicken parm were both good, but the vodka sauce was so amazing that they just couldn't compare. The staff was the perfect combination of nice and efficient. They moved us through the phases of lunch quickly, but without feeling rushed. Easy 5-stars for us!

    We've driven past Cafe Italia so many times and were always curious about it, so we finally decided…read moreto stop in for a late Saturday lunch. If you are looking for a charming, "no-frills" spot for classic Italian-American comfort food, this is a very dependable option. The absolute highlight of our visit was the staff. The people here couldn't have been nicer! They were welcoming and extremely accommodating, especially when it came to customizing my order. Food: * House Salads: We started with the house salads featuring their homemade tomato vinaigrette. It was unique--it tasted like they might incorporate some of their tomato sauce into the dressing base. It was okay, though perhaps an acquired taste if you prefer a sharper vinaigrette. * Eggplant Parm & Custom Pasta: I ordered the Eggplant Parm and asked to swap the side pasta for angel hair with vodka sauce. They were happy to do it for a small upcharge. The eggplant itself was quite good! My only critique is that the sauce was very chunky (I like a smoother sauce) and the portion of it was a bit overwhelming, but that might just be a personal preference. * Fettuccine Alfredo: My husband went with the classic Alfredo. He described it as a "solid 7/10"--nothing was wrong with it at all, just a standard, reliable version of the dish that satisfied the craving. Final Thoughts Cafe Italia is a sweet little place that is a decent option if you're hungry for the classics and want to be treated like family. We're glad we finally checked it off our list!
